Sometimes you don’t need the stress of choosing what to watch.

The future of streaming is ads

It’s the same bargain as TikTok and YouTube, but what I’ve found really compelling about FAST TV isn’t the affordability or the solid array of content; it’s how liberating it feels to remove some of the choice from the situation. When I’m trying to binge-watch a show, there’s always the sense I need to pay attention; there’s a small level of stress to make sure I don’t miss anything. And it’s not just for new shows.

and felt no anxiety. I wasn’t needing to track where I was in a rewatch or make sure I didn’t miss a scene or episode. The stakes were lower, and I was fine leaving it on while I vacuumed up more dog hair than I thought my dog was capable of shedding. And unlike more social media-driven stuff such as TikTok and YouTube — which also shove free content in your face for the low, low price of your attention on occasional ads — I wasn’t having to babysit Pluto. I didn’t need to pick the next thing or accidentally futz up an algorithm by letting something autoplay. I didn’t need to flick up on my phone to see the next show. I could just tune in on my TV and continue on with my day.

This behavior isn’t a stranger to everyone — my mom leaves HGTV on in every room of her house. But it’s increasingly alien behavior for a lot of us. If you’re like me, you’ve just gotten used to bingeing or watchingin bite-size clips on TikTok next to cake decorating videos.
